The song starts off by saying “Said you belong to the streets but the streets belong to me.” To understand this quote you have to think about it figuratively. If you understand New York slang, you would know that “belonging to the streets” refers to someone who can’t be committed as they are dating as many people as they want; Essentially you are someone who can’t be wifed up, or a h*e. When Drake starts off the song with these lyrics, what he really is saying is, “okay I know you talking to other people, no strings attached, but the streets belong to me; I really run this player mindset/behavior more than you do.” From the beginning of the song it is foreshadowed that this woman wasn’t someone he could have a relationship with but he decided to do so otherwise. In the background of the song you hear drums and a person saying “oh oh oh” smoothly in different octaves. He then, however, goes to explain the things he did for this woman. He says, “I tatted your passport up now it’s looking like an arm sleeve/ just know that was all me.” He flew her out to many different countries which is why her passport is tatted up, in other words, stamped everywhere.
